Making any major purchase requires expert knowledge. Choosing is no exception. Spinning shoes are an incredibly specialized product. To start with, I suggest shopping at the bike shop that are experts in fitting biking shoes. Employees must be well versed on fitting techniques and proper fit. It's not as simple as planning to buy a couple of tennis shoes. A trained staff is an excellent resource. Considering the level of days you will spend in your spinning shoes, it's well worth it to ensure you get a shoe which fits.Similar to buying dress shoes or some other shoe, you'll turn out trying on several pairs of spinning shoes before you wind up with one which feels just made for you. Some are thin, some are wide, some fit too loosely, some run too big or too small, etc. In this respect, it is similar to buying other pairs of shoes. They are all a little different.Bring socks along that would be typical of the socks you'll wear when at your spin cla ss. Don't try to fit spinning shoes along with your work socks or any other sock that wouldn't be conventional what you'll wear. This may seem simple, but you would be surprised the number of bikers take back biking shoes simply because they say they do not fit like they did inside the store. In most cases, they bought spin shoes without wearing socks they would wear for spinning. If you are just how to get started and aren't positive what socks you'll wear, I would recommend finding a moisture wicking sock. You can purchase those at most sporting goods stores. They might cost a little more, but are worth the more money.As a first word of advice, get spin shoes with Velcro fasteners. I know, your initial thought is that it seems like something a kid can be wearing. For bikers and spinners, there's practical function to this particular however. As you cycle, shoes strings can simply get wrapped throughout the pedals or tangled in a sprocket or belt. You really don't want to know w hat happens what a string gets tangled when you are riding. Get Velcro.Spinning shoes will feel odd when you try them on. They have a rigid layer towards balls of one's feet where you will be applying pressure while pedaling. Don't worry. This is normal. While standing still, they'll feel great. When walking, they'll feel a bit clumsy. Spin shoes are not designed for running and also you shouldn't be trying it. You'll be all right walking around in them however when you are not on the spin bike. They'll be perfectly acceptable for working out with weight machines. Stay over elipticals as well as other machines requiring impact using your feet. You shouldn't buy a spinning shoe with no rigid toe area. Some expert biking shoes won't have a rigid toe. For the daily spinner, you should avoid advanced shoes.You'll also realize that some spinning shoes look much like regular hiking or workout shoes plus some look unusual with the toe area slick and smooth. There actually is no reason to purchase ones using the slick toe area. Get the shoes that seem to be like standard shoes. The spinning shoes with the slick toe area could only be used clipped into your pedals. The shoes that seem to be normal contain the cleat just slightly recessed and work very well for other activities within the club and basic walking around. The bikers I know who ended up using the slick toes regret their selection. Buy the ones that appear to be like normal shoes.Next time you go to your spin class, ask your teachers what kinds of cleats are essential for the spin bikes within your class. Most all bikes anymore use S PD cleats but you can find exceptions. This is a very important step. You'll have to get spinning shoes that actually work with cleats that can work with all the spin bikes in your gym. When you put on spin shoes, pay particular attention to your heal slipping. If the heal doesn't stay firmly inside shoe, you will develop blisters. You'll obviously be abandoning your shoes quickly if you develop blisters.Getting properly fitted shoes is not a difficult task but it must be taken as seriously as getting a running shoe. You'll spend thousands of hours on the spinning bike with your spin shoes. A proper fit is crucial.
